PA Virtual Honor Society Earns Governor's Civic Engagement Award

2020-Silver-Seal PA Virtual’s Rho Kappa National Social Studies Honor Society, led by High School History and Government teachers Ms. Svoboda and Mr. Davis, successfully earned the Governor’s Civic Engagement Silver Award.


The Governor’s Civic Engagement Award is presented by the Pennsylvania Departments of State and Education. The award celebrates the efforts of Pennsylvania high school students to educate, engage and inform their fellow students about how to get involved in the voting process.

The Silver Level School Award is presented to schools where 65% of eligible students are registered to vote.

Members of PA Virtual’s Rho Kappa chapter had to plan and execute a voter registration drive, make a plan to count the number of registrations collected, and calculate the percent of eligible students registered at PA Virtual.

Because of their efforts, both the Rho Kappa students and PA Virtual will receive a plaque and certificates from the Secretary of State at a regional recognition event.

Among the 42 schools in Pennsylvania that earned awards, PA Virtual Charter School is the first statewide virtual school to earn the award.
